Avici's RAPID uses advanced software and routing algorithms to dramatically improve the recovery speed or "convergence time" resulting from a network disruption. The need to improve convergence times is paramount as IP networks shift from carrying "best effort" data traffic to delivering Real- Time applications such as voice, video, business applications, and interactive gaming. Traditional routers can take tens of seconds to recover and route traffic around network disruptions, during which time data and service connections are lost. By deploying Avici's RAPID, carriers can realize a 10X improvement in convergence times, enabling them to achieve a new level of network reliability and stability. This network performance improvement positions carriers to capture high margin premium IP services and demanding Real-Time applications. RAPID can also contribute to reducing operational costs by minimizing service disruptions and the associated customer service and maintenance activities. Avici's routers are purpose-built for the stresses and demands of carrier core routing. Avici's TSR(R), SSR(TM) and QSR(TM) routers, are built using a highly distributed architecture for optimal performance, stability and scalability.
